Global environmental, health and safety (EHS) risks are managed by the Global EHS Management System (GEHSMS) at PepsiCo. GEHSMS is based on the PepsiCo Environment, Health and Safety Policy, one of the key principles of which is environmental protection and ensuring human health and safety. According to the EHS08 Standard (Competence, Training, Knowledge), all employees and contractors of PepsiCo undergo EHS training which aims to develop appropriate competences among staff in planning and reporting processes. PepsiCo believes that the staff training is decisive for the company's success. The company ensures that the training topics are maximally adjusted to the work responsibilities of employees.

PepsiCo also provides periodic re-training for the purpose of refreshing information and updating knowledge. The training need is outlined based on the specifics of the particular work position. For each topic, reading material is prepared taking into consideration all the required regulations and standards. Knowledge and skills evaluation tests are also elaborated upon need. The total number of environmental training hours in 2017 amounted to 180. From January to September 2018, the number environmental training hours reached 430.
